This market lets participants express expectations about the outcome of the football match between Johor Darul Ta'zim (JDT) and Sanfrecce Hiroshima. It matters because it aggregates information about team strength, match conditions, and market sentiment ahead of the fixture.
Johor Darul Ta'zim is a dominant club in Malaysian football with growing experience in regional competitions; Sanfrecce Hiroshima is an established J1 League side with a history of competing at a higher domestic level. Matches between Southeast Asian champions and J‑League clubs often highlight differences in resources, tactical approaches, and squad depth, and the competitive context (league, continental competition, or friendly) shapes each side's priorities.

Long-distance travel, limited recovery days, or congested schedules can increase fatigue and prompt squad rotation, often favoring the side with more depth or the home team with less travel disruption.
A three‑outcome market typically offers Home Win (Johor Darul Ta'zim), Draw, and Away Win (Hiroshima). Settlement is based on the official match result as defined by the market rules—usually the score at the end of regulation time—so check the event page for any exceptions (extra time or penalties).
